Designed for patients missing one or more teeth, this restoration utilizes CAD/CAM digital workflows to recreate natural tooth morphology. The process begins with a precise digital scan of the patient's mouth, followed by 3D printing the denture base and teeth to ensure a perfect anatomical match with the patient's gums and remaining dentition.

1. What is the fabrication process for 3D printed dentures?
Our 3D printed dentures are born from a fully digital workflow. It
begins with a high-definition intraoral scan of the patient's
mouth, which creates a precise 3D CAD (Computer-Aided Design) file.
This digital blueprint is then sent to industrial-grade 3D printers
that build the denture layer-by-layer using medical-grade
biocompatible resins. This eliminates the inaccuracies often found
in traditional stone models and manual wax-ups.

3. What is the expected durability of a printed denture?
With proper care and maintenance, a high-quality 3D printed denture is designed to last between 8 to 10 years. The advanced resins used today are engineered for high impact resistance and color stability to withstand the rigors of daily use.
